    Neighbors Complain The band name "Neighbors Complain" stems from who they are, that is loud and noisy street musicians from their pre-debut days. From the beginning, there was no doubt to the reference when the "Neighbors Complain"! "Neighbors Complain" is an R&B band formed in their hometown Osaka in 2014. Although all four members claim their roots in black music, the x-factor to spellbind their fans came from the groove which was created by the unique fusion of each member's strong personality within the music. One night on the streets of Osaka, their musicianship caught the eyes and ears of foreign performers from Universal Studio Japan (USJ), and "Neighbors Complain" became the backup band at USJ. In 2015, while growing as a band, their excelled live performances on USJ stages led to further opportunities for name acts such as "Gospelers", Chikuzen Sato of "Sing Like Talking", Kaname Nemoto of "Stardust Review",Yu Sakai, and Kaori Kishitani of "Princes Princes".
